Just met Charlie yesterday at a Busker Festival... not only the best cups and ball I have ever seen (He got me with the final loads even though I knew they were coming!) but also has some great theories on performing surrounded and perfecting sleight of hand technique. We have a wonderful little chat, a real gentleman and honest guy. And he really knows how to handle the crowd!

Jim Cellini is a master and an amazing man. One thing that always strikes me when I hear stories about him is how he helped people who really needed it and always stood up for the little guy. I have huge respect and love. He is the legend.

Gazzo is obviously a genius. And he is not always an insult comedian, magicians believe this because when he works for magicians he hams it up. He knows how to adapt to an audience, and I saw him do a super sweet and really magical show in Edinburgh the other year (which ran 15 min into my timeslot by the way. He apologized for running over afterwards, and I could only say it was the best use for my 15 min I've ever seen).

Nick Nickolas is also amazing. Extremely funny. He's a good friend, and a real gentleman. The first time I went to Australia, I flew in from Japan, and when I landed I went straight to the Melbourne pitch. The first thing Nick said was -"Great to see you here Charlie. You wanna do 10 min as a warmup for a comedy TV show tonight?". Two weeks later I was on Oz TV thanks to that. I never tire of watching his show.

Peter Wardell. Helped me so much when I was starting out in Covent Garden. I owe much of my performing skills to Pete, and he is definitely one of the strongest magic shows out there. I've seen so much funny, random stuff happen in Pete's show, he must have some way of creating strange incidents.

Kenny Lightfoot. A very original and sweet show. Well defined character. Funny, original jokes. Very smart man.
